How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Chapman Ranch?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Chapman Ranch Studio Apartments | $822 | $565 | $1,199 |
Chapman Ranch 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,093 | $635 | $1,827 |
Chapman Ranch 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,406 | $815 | $2,239 |
Chapman Ranch 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,849 | $1,125 | $2,894 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Chapman Ranch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Chapman Ranch?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Chapman Ranch with Washer/Dryer is at Caspian Apartments listed at $565.
How much is the average rent for Chapman Ranch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Chapman Ranch with Washer/Dryer is $1,420.
What is the largest Chapman Ranch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Chapman Ranch is a 1,714 square feet unit starting from $1,359 at Azali Heights.
What is the average size for Chapman Ranch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Chapman Ranch is currently at 707 sq ft.
